Hunza Tour Overview

Hunza Valley Cherry Blossom Tour to explore the mountains valley of Hunza during cherry blossom season. The beginning of the cherry blossom indicates the end of cold winters in Hunza Valley and other different valleys of Gilgit-Baltistan. It means the arrival of the spring season in Hunza Valley, which starts from mid-March to the last week of April. So, it is the perfect time for travellers to grab the beauty of cherry blossom Hunza. Cherry blossom season in Hunza attracts visitors through the scenic views of the blooming of cherry blossom petals and the blossom of Apricots, apples, pears, and various fruits.

In the spring season, Hunza presents an aesthetic panorama to the sightseers. Hunza Valley lies on the old Silk Road the modern Karakoram Highway to China. This valley with sleepy villages, colourful cherry blossoms, whispering creeks, and vast massive glaciers is surrounded by the highest ridges all around the northern side of Pakistan, which genuinely offers a beautiful landscape and a peaceful environment to travellers. DRIVE TO KARIMABAD (150km) 5 HOURS:

In the morning you continue your Hunza spring tour towards Karimabad on the Karakoram Highway along the mighty Indus and Hunza River.

The real attractions of Pakistan are in the north and to get there we need to travel along the world’s highest paved road, The Karakoram Highway. Travelling along The Karakoram Highway is an unforgettable experience; you will see peaks and valleys, rivers and glaciers. Twenty-one of the world’s one hundred highest peaks are visible from the KKH, and the journey is a great introduction to the mountains as civilization slips away behind us.

D-4

REST DAY & SIGHTSEEING IN KARIMABAD (2,440m):

Karimabad is the ancient Capital of Hunza Valley, it is the gateway to the mountains and a great place to unwind for a day. Wander the cobblestone streets, bargain for rubies and handicrafts, feast on Hunza cuisine, get to grips with the dark history of Baltit Fort, take a peek at the Silk Road from Altit Fort and watch the sunset over the river below.

HEALTH & VACCINATION

You should contact your doctor or travel clinic to check whether you specifically require any vaccinations or other preventive measures. You should be up to date with routine courses and boosters as recommended in the UK e.g. diphtheria-tetanus-polio and measles-mumps-rubella), along with hepatitis A and typhoid. Malarial prophylaxis is discretionary for this trip. Malaria exists in the area around Islamabad. However, incidences of urban transmission of malaria are extremely low. On holidays to more remote areas, you should also have a dentist check-up. A good online resource is Travel Health Pro. Dengue fever is a known risk in places visited. It is a tropical viral disease spread by daytime-biting mosquitoes. There is currently no vaccine or prophylaxis available and therefore the best form of prevention is to avoid being bitten. We recommend you take precautions to avoid mosquito bites

CLIMATE

From mid-March to May, we can expect to encounter temperatures as high as 30°C at Islamabad, Naran and Gilgit, and 25°C in Hunza Valley. Weather is generally good throughout the summer season, with clear skies and little rain or snow. However, weather in mountainous areas is difficult to predict, and short-lived storms can occur at any time.

PAKISTAN VISA

All nationalities require a visa. The visa fee is approximately GBP 30, and you must apply for it before departure. To obtain a visa for Pakistan you will require a letter of introduction from an approved agency which Trango Adventure will provide. Visa applications can be made online or in person at your nearest Pakistan embassy. For more information about visa procedure please check our Blog and news section.
